Flow Characteristics Around Various Bluff Body Geometries in Shallow Water Flow

Author(s): M. F. Tachie; S. S. Paul; C. Katopodis

Abstract: The paper reports on an experimental study of turbulent near wake of shallow open channel. The experiments were conducted for square, circular, and trapezoidalshape cylinders. The Reynolds number based on depth of flow and boundary layer momentum thickness, were, respectively, 19,500 and 1,540. Correspondingly, the Froude number was 0.3 indicating that the flow is in the sub-critical regime. A particle image velocimetry technique was used to conduct velocity measurements around and in the near wake of the cylinder models, from which iso-contours and profiles of the mean velocities and turbulent statistics were obtained and discussed. A strong link between the cross-sections of the leading surfaces of the cylinders on the near wake patterns is observed.
